Northwest played a tough game on Friday in which they were outscored in every quarter. They were outmatched by Madison Prep Academy and fell 73-44. The defeat continues a trend for the Raiders in their matchups with Madison Prep Academy: they've now lost three in a row.
Northwest's loss dropped their record down to 1-1. As for Madison Prep Academy, they pushed their record up to 6-2 with the win, which was their 20th straight at home dating back to last season.
Northwest will take on Lake Charles College Prep in a holiday battle at at 7:00 p.m. on Monday. As for Madison Prep Academy, they won't have much time to rest: their next contest is against Woodlawn-B.R. at 5:30 p.m. on Saturday.
